From e78e921fc16dad87c144acd4b2428139b051d528 Mon Sep 17 00:00:00 2001 From: xiekeyang Date: Fri, 14 Apr 2017 11:58:07 +0800 Subject: [PATCH] remove temporary dir The temporary directory had better to be removed after test case finished. Signed-off-by: xiekeyang --- fs/copy_test.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/fs/copy_test.go b/fs/copy_test.go index 816de8f99..475e76fdf 100644 --- a/fs/copy_test.go +++ b/fs/copy_test.go @@ -2,6 +2,7 @@ package fs import ( "io/ioutil" + "os" "testing" _ "crypto/sha256" @@ -36,10 +37,13 @@ func testCopy(apply fstest.Applier) error { if err != nil { return errors.Wrap(err, "failed to create temporary directory") } + defer os.RemoveAll(t1) + t2, err := ioutil.TempDir("", "test-copy-dst-") if err != nil { return errors.Wrap(err, "failed to create temporary directory") } + defer os.RemoveAll(t2) if err := apply.Apply(t1); err != nil { return errors.Wrap(err, "failed to apply changes")